If you’re breastfeeding, your newborn will have about two to three poos each day. after the first week, she may poo after each feed, so that can mean as many as 12 poos each day. this will slowly settle down and, by three to four weeks, she may only poo every few days. (chertoff and gill 2018a, healthlink bc 2019a) . Black or dark green. after birth, the first stool a baby passes is black or dark green and tarry. this type of baby poop is known as meconium. yellow green. your baby's poop may turn this color once the meconium stool has passed. yellow. breastfed newborns usually have seedy, loose stool that looks like light mustard.

According to the national library of medicine, some signs of constipation in babies include: excessive fussiness. spitting up more often than usual. trouble passing stools. hard, dry stools. pain.
